Output 643fc610a98db916105de38cde7aced72b59bd786524fdb8e56704b0fe3795f0:1

value
78140455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95a5e89437c506895a1e72f481f805d527b73a0 OP_EQUAL
address
3H8UNvwkKxBN97cFx3wLNPjBYUQ84DzAS9
transaction
643fc610a98db916105de38cde7aced72b59bd786524fdb8e56704b0fe3795f0
spent
true